Sage Tea

π¨βπ³ Instructions
In an Earthenware teapot, place tea leaves, sage, mint and sugar.
Stir until sugar is well blended.
Pour in boiling water. Stir again.
Cover and brew 5 to 10 minutes.
Serve in tea glasses with lemon on side.
Makes 4 to 5 teacups
